Lazada PH: The rising Ecommerce website in the company

It’s has been a challenging market for any investor in the Philippines when it comes to putting up an online business. Investing on the Ecommerce industry in South East Asia is really no joke in the past. The capable to pay online market audience were actually still very low at that time. Most of them are not even credit card owners. As for the minority credit card owners, not all of them are willing to pay via online. It's no surprise that it's the reaction in South East Asia since online frauds and scams happen most of the time. It's actually more credible to deal with offline businesses rather than online businesses we often get a feeling that dealing offline face-to-face is much better than not seeing who you are dealing with in online. Sadly, most of us are considering that they are actual legit online stores that we are overlooking.

Usually, online malls offer better discounts and pricing since they don’t pay for their store rent like how offline malls do. Online stores making them a more enticing option regularly offer discounts and promos. They really need to offer it to get noticed by the customers and try online shopping as an alternative. Lazada is one of those online mall website who is also available across South East Asia. They are one of the first in the country to offer the biggest selections among the local online stores in the Philippines. It was the first time that Cash on Delivery or C.O.D. was offered by an online store, which they introduced here in the country.  Although, this may have been widely used in the past by another industry, which is the food delivery industry. This mark the first time any online mall in the country has offered that.

This paved way for them to become one of the key players in the online shopping industry. Recently, they just celebrated their first ever anniversary and already achieved so much. Upon their arrival on the country, that's when their competitors showed one by one. Upon their arrival in the Philippines, clearly showed that they now realize the potential of the local Ecommerce industry. We can only watch as online shopping takes off in the coming years. They won the favor of the local customers through their unconventional approach as an online store in the country.

Now that they have Cash on Delivery, they now tap customers that can’t pay in credit card. This eventually multiplied the numbers of their market since almost everyone can now become their customers. They even offer free delivery availability as long as the transaction value exceeds one thousand pesos. Shipment fees will be waived as long as transaction is not lower than one thousand pesos. It's is much easier for them to convince customers to choose online shopping rather than offline shopping since they can combine Cash on Delivery or C.O.D. and Free Delivery. This combination was the game-changing factor for online users to try online shopping.
